 Somewhere in 2015, the legendary Graham Norton accepted that at 52 he was still single and felt like he had failed at his chance of finding love because most people, by the time they are his age, are settled. This seems to be the case with the majority of gay men and Norton's words perfectly echo the thoughts and feelings most of them go through after moving past 45 years. This is because, after you reach a certain age, the vitality of life automatically curbs itself and you start wondering will you ever find the love of your life or just remain single forever.

There’s a sense of nonchalant resignation after a point where disappointment and loneliness take a backseat and all one is left with are blank thoughts and the never-ending string of consolation that says, “there’s someone out there for everybody”. But, who has ever tested the authenticity of this statement? Had it really been this way, everyone on earth would have found a partner, including the gay men and delineated their happily ever after(s). 

As far as looking for love is concerned, the scenario is quite different and way more difficult in the case of gay men as compared to straight men. No matter how firmly we try to establish ourselves supremely as individuals, the truth that man is a social being should and can never leave our consciousness. Since our childhood, we have time and again been conditioned by the preconceived norms of the society and there are certain notions that have left a huge imprint in our minds. Even in the 21st century, being gay is frowned upon and there appears no escape from it anytime soon. There are so many men who label themselves as straight and get married to women just to avoid the critical radar of society. This implies that men who truly accept their sexual preferences are left with a narrowed array to explore their possibilities and after a certain age, neither the mind nor the body supports us in seeking an area that has been proven hopeless a multiple times. 

Love is indeed the sweetest feeling and therapy for all the terrible things that life throws at us- the feeling balances all the tribulations with the virtues of hope, comfort, happiness, and safety which qualify as the indispensables of wellbeing. There's no way we can fight feelings; under no circumstances can we deny that one can live a happy and full life without having a significant other by his side but, love makes it all the more beautiful. In the gay community, muscles and youthful beauty hold a higher value than all the other attributes which means, the older men are hardly left with any room to compete. Moreover, looking for love in places you have already sought it in can gradually turn out to be an excruciating experience and this when the heart shrieks to stop and get some respite from the constant rejections and consequently, resign from the chase.
